Switchboard Operator Jobs in District of Columbia
A Switchboard Operator plays a vital role in facilitating effective communication within an organization. They are chiefly responsible for handling incoming, outgoing, and interoffice calls and directing them to the appropriate departments or individuals. Their tasks may also extend to maintaining phone system performance, recording and relaying messages, and sometimes performing administrative duties such as filing, data entry, and record keeping.
Switchboard Operators should possess excellent interpersonal and communication skills, as they often serve as the first point of contact for clients or visitors. They should also have good organizational abilities and be familiar with computer and telephone systems. A high school diploma or its equivalent is typically required, but a certification in office administration or a related field may be beneficial. Prior to becoming a Switchboard Operator, one could hold roles such as Receptionist, Customer Service Representative, or Office Assistant which would provide relevant experience in handling calls and performing administrative tasks.
